Key Components of the Retraction System
At the heart of the retraction mechanism lies the hose and the connection points. The hose is the flexible conduit that allows the faucet to extend and retreat. Within this system, specific pull out faucet parts ensure a secure seal and prevent leaks under pressure.

- The Slide Rail: This is the track or guide that keeps the faucet head moving in a straight line as it is pulled or pushed.
- The Spring: A tension spring is usually responsible for the automatic retraction, pulling the hose back into the faucet body when released.
- The Washer and Seal: These small but vital components create a watertight barrier where the hose connects to the valve body.
Valve Cartridge and Handle Assembly
Turning the handle activates the valve cartridge, which is another core element among pull out faucet parts. This cartridge controls the flow and temperature of the water. If the handle is stiff or leaks occur around the base, it is often an indication that the cartridge or its surrounding seals need attention.

Troubleshooting Common Failures
When a pull out faucet malfunctions, the issue usually traces back to wear and tear on these fundamental parts. A sprayer that won't stay in place might have a faulty locking nut or a broken clip inside the handle assembly. Identifying the specific component that is failing makes the repair process significantly faster.
Leaks are the most common complaint, and they often originate from the areas where the static parts meet the moving parts. Mineral buildup from hard water can degrade the performance of the spray head and the valve seat over time. Regular cleaning and the occasional replacement of rubber washers can extend the life of these intricate pull out faucet parts significantly.

Material Quality and Longevity
The durability of these parts is directly linked to the material used. High-end faucets often utilize brass or stainless steel for the core structure, while the washers and seals are made from rubber or synthetic polymers.
